Transaction 35cfdea0696d5cbf23b5342fb3295933c7207113501609fe4dfbcd9bc74a349a
1 Input
2 Outputs
- 35cfdea0696d5cbf23b5342fb3295933c7207113501609fe4dfbcd9bc74a349a:0
- 35cfdea0696d5cbf23b5342fb3295933c7207113501609fe4dfbcd9bc74a349a:1
value 96887749
address 1H9HiiGrtH9Z8siiJ9yRJuDcSBGQWHgErs
value 257988565
address 3BMEXkcaAMQvgSojKCccDwAmKpcGcJ4C25